Embrace Warm Textiles

When winter arrives, embracing warm textiles can transform your home into a cozy retreat. Consider adding thick, knitted blankets, plush rugs, and soft curtains to your space. These elements not only provide warmth but also create an inviting atmosphere. Choose rich fabrics like velvet or wool in warm hues to enhance comfort and style, making your home a perfect winter sanctuary.
Layer up With Throws and Pillows

Warm textiles create a snug atmosphere, but layering up with throws and pillows takes comfort to the next level. Choose a mix of sizes, textures, and colors to add depth and visual interest. Toss soft, chunky knits or elegant velvets onto your sofa and bed. This simple touch not only enhances coziness but also elevates your home’s winter aesthetic effortlessly.
Incorporate Natural Elements

To create a truly inviting winter space, you can incorporate natural elements that bring the beauty of the outdoors inside. Consider using pinecones, branches, and fresh greenery to enhance your decor. Arrange them in vases or bowls for a rustic touch. You might also add textured elements like woven baskets or wooden accents to create a warm, cozy atmosphere that feels both chic and inviting.

Use Seasonal Colors

Embracing seasonal colors can transform your winter decor into a vibrant reflection of the season’s beauty. Incorporate rich jewel tones like emerald green, deep blue, or ruby red to create warmth. Pair these with soft neutrals for balance. Don’t forget to add pops of icy whites and silvery hues to capture the essence of winter, making your space feel inviting and chic.

Decorate With Winter Florals

As winter settles in, incorporating seasonal florals can bring warmth and life to your decor. Consider using deep reds, whites, and greens in arrangements featuring amaryllis, poinsettias, or evergreen sprigs. Display them in elegant vases or clusters on tabletops. You can also create wreaths or garlands for added charm. These simple touches will elevate your space and create a cozy, inviting atmosphere.

Create a Winter Wreath

Mirrors can enhance the ambiance of your home, but don’t overlook the charm of a beautifully crafted winter wreath. Start with a sturdy base, then layer evergreen branches, pinecones, and berries for texture. Add a splash of color with seasonal ornaments or a ribbon. Hang it on your door or inside to welcome the cozy winter vibe, making your home feel warm and inviting.

Opt for Seasonal Scents

While winter’s chill settles in, filling your home with seasonal scents can create a warm and inviting atmosphere. Consider using candles or essential oils with fragrances like cinnamon, pine, or vanilla. Simmering spices on the stove or placing fresh evergreen branches around can also enhance the cozy vibe. These scents not only elevate your decor but also wrap your home in a comforting embrace.
